I'm learning how to work on my 98 Volvo s70 so I can afford to keep it and this tool has been indispensable for my trouble shooting for the following reasons:
1) Defines the code for you, this means you aren't always looking at a book or website to figure out what's up.
2) Backlit. If you find yourself out occasionally at night checking vacuum lines and other minor things, the fact you can read the screen is helpful.
3) Reads "pending" codes that have yet to register as a check engine light. This means you see a problem before it becomes urgent. The live data will help some on this issue as well, but I'm still figuring out where my vehicle should be. I have been impressed with the amount of live data I get on the machine given that I have a European car.
All in all, if you're fixing your own car you have enough stress on you without going back and forth from autozone to get codes read or having to look up new and mysterious codes. This is a great tool for a beginnine DIYer like me.
